While all can agree on the wording of the first line of the heading, the subtitle is provocative but intentionally chosen. What will it take to bring about equal opportunities for women and men in science? Will change come about in academia as a result of a general understanding that women and men can and should contribute equally to science and innovation or do we need a crisis for change to happen? With decades of committed work on equal opportunity and equity in academia, and the limited tangible results and impact achieved, it is worth considering aspects such as specific instruments, interventions and good practice examples which could assist us in bringing about more significant and tangible progress.
